group to merge uk growth, uk equity income, balanced, growth and income into single fund
Former Mercury UK manager Paul Harwood is returning to the fund's industry acting as adviser on Solus' forthcoming Flagship fund. The vehicle is being created through the merger of a number of the group's existing portfolios. As part of a planned range rationalisation, moving from 17 funds down to just eight, the group will combine its UK Growth, UK Equity Income and its Balanced, Growth and Income portfolios, into one the single manager UK Flagship.
